Juicy Greek Chicken Burgers with Tzatziki Bliss

Experience the flavor of the Mediterranean with these Juicy Greek Chicken Burgers packed with herbs and a refreshing tzatziki sauce.

  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

  • 1 lb Ground Chicken (93% lean)
  • 1/2 cup Feta Cheese (or goat cheese)
  • 1 medium Onion (finely chopped)
  • 3 cloves Garlic (minced)
  • 1/4 cup Fresh Parsley (or dill)
  • 1 tsp Dried Oregano
  • 1 tsp Salt
  • 1/2 tsp Black Pepper (freshly ground)
  • 1/4 tsp Red Pepper Flakes (optional)
  • 1 tbsp Lemon Zest
  • 1 tbsp Lemon Juice
  • 1/2 cup Breadcrumbs (or almond flour)
  • 1 Large Egg (for binding)
  • 1 cup Tzatziki Sauce
  • 2 cups Fresh Vegetables (lettuce, sliced tomatoes, cucumbers)
  • 4 pieces Buns or Pita (whole grain or gluten-free)

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, combine the ground chicken, feta cheese, finely chopped onion, and minced garlic.
  2. Add in the herbs and spices: fresh parsley or dill, dried oregano, salt, black pepper, red pepper flakes, lemon zest, lemon juice, breadcrumbs or almond flour, and egg. Mix well but avoid overworking the mixture.
  3. Form the mixture into patties, about ¾-inch thick. Start a grill or heat a skillet over medium heat, lightly oiling if needed. Cook the patties for about five minutes on each side or until they reach an internal temperature of 165°F. Toast the buns on the grill near the end of cooking.
  4. Serve the burgers with a generous dollop of tzatziki and add fresh veggies to assemble.

Notes

These burgers are versatile; for gluten-free options, use almond flour instead of breadcrumbs. You can also make them dairy-free by omitting feta or using a non-dairy cheese.
